Using default value in a virtual/override function is not a good idea. It may cause problem if the default value is different.
However, I'll mark it in the TODO list and refactor it in the following PRs.
Example for causing confusing result:
> cat a.cpp
#include <iostream>
#include <memory>
struct A {
virtual void f(int x=999) {
std::cout << "A::f() called with x=" << x << "\n";
}
};
struct B : public A {
void f(int x=100) override {
std::cout << "B::f() called with x=" << x << "\n";
}
};
struct C: public A {};
int main()
{
std::unique_ptr<A> base_ptr_to_a = std::make_unique<A>();
base_ptr_to_a->f();
std::unique_ptr<A> base_ptr_to_b = std::make_unique<B>();
base_ptr_to_b->f();
std::unique_ptr<B> ptr_to_b = std::make_unique<B>();
ptr_to_b->f();
}
> g++ a.cpp -std=c++17 && ./a.out
A::f() called with x=999
B::f() called with x=999
B::f() called with x=100
